Markem-Imaje, A Dover Company, is a trusted world manufacturer of product identification and traceability solutions, offering a full line of reliable and innovative inkjet, thermal transfer, laser, print and apply label systems. Markem-Imaje delivers fully integrated solutions that enable product quality and safety, regulatory and retailer compliance, better product recalls and improved manufacturing processes.

 

The Mechanical Engineer Lead will be part of a global, cross-disciplinary team implementing, validating and maintaining mechanical subsystems for Markem-Imaje current and future printers. You will have the opportunity to work with talented engineers in a global environment, building complex products, from proof of concept to production, across a variety of printing technologies targeted to meet our customers’ needs and the strategic objectives of Markem-Imaje.

 

Dover is a diversified global manufacturer with annual revenue of over $8 billion. We deliver innovative equipment and components, specialty systems, consumable supplies, software and digital solutions, and support services through five operating segments: Engineered Products, Fueling Solutions, Imaging & Identification, Pumps & Process Solutions and Refrigeration & Food Equipment. Headquartered in Downers Grove, Illinois, Dover trades on the New York Stock Exchange under "DOV." Additional information is available at dovercorporation.com.

 

 

 

Job Responsibilities: 

• Drive quality and efficiency within the Mechanical Engineering team by setting an outstanding example in terms of high-quality design and analysis with your individual work. 
• Perform and guide CAD design, engineering computer simulations, and mechanical engineering related lab experiment in support of design validation and reliability goals. 
• Bring a strong technical expertise during design reviews and problem-solving activities. 
• Deploy state of the art mechanical engineering development practices (such as rapid prototyping, tolerance stack analysis, FEA simulation, etc.) 
• Work with global mechanical discipline to facilitate implementation and improvement of best practices and tools to improve team efficiency, effectiveness, and mechanical subsystem quality.
• Use outstanding communication and interpersonal skills to lead and create efficient interfaces with third party engineering partners. 
• Ensure smooth and efficient transfer of new design and updates to the supply chain team 
• Work package leader for mechanical elements of NPI developments 
• Coach and mentor the local mechanical engineering team. 

 

Job Requirements: 

• Master’s degree in Mechanical Engineering. 
• Minimum 10 years of experience in various Mechanical engineering R&D roles within an industrial environment is required. Knowledge of marking and coding equipment is a plus but not required. 
• Experience designing industrial products from concept through production is required. 
• Experience in CAD design (Creo/Windchill preferred), FEA and thermal/pneumatics/electro-mechanical testing is desired. 
• Minimum of 5 years’ experience performing engineering team leadership within an industrial manufacturing environment.
